In Austin, Nanakos Sees ZIKI Tesla-Like Model for Restaurants

He’s in Austin, Texas for now but Nick Nanakos thinks his ZIKI – short  for tzatziki – concept for restaurants could become a template for the world in the industry and he even got investors from Tesla owner Elon Musk’s backers.

He told Austonia that he’s on a vision quest for a “multi-decade, global-scale conquest to build the most significant company to ever exist in food,” and has the Sparta and Macedonia ancestry to take on the challenge.

His plan is to go industrial and optimize elements including ingredients, chefs, cooking techniques, agriculture, teams, factories, real estate, systems, technology, design, and logistics.

“ZIKI is approaching restaurants the same way Tesla approaches cars – with a master plan to be the fastest, most creative company in the category,” said investor Ryan Metzger.

ZIKI is a fast-casual restaurant serving Greek & Mexican fusion including dishes like zurritos among other signature plates.

Nanakos said, “our vision is to become the fastest-growing restaurant company on the planet, with unstoppable unit economics,” using the largest commercial kitchen in the state, preparing food on site, using delivery vans, and identifying areas with the highest order volumes.
